I am looking for insurance for a 3 day trip to Istanbul and have been quoted locally, 40 Euros for 2 of us. Does anyone know if this is the normal rate? I have tried the 2 sites mentioned earlier in this thread and neither will cover me. For Bengotravel I have to have been resident in the UK for the previous 6 months, which I have not, and with Staysure the expat policy does not cover travel to Cyprus or Turkey. Does anyone know of any other company that offers cover for TRNC and Turkey and that does not stipulate being resident in the UK or the trip starting from the UK to qualify?

Found this on the BRS website - thought the problems with staysure had been sorted out - they keep sending me reminders but I haven't needed to buy in the last year.

'Esta Insurance provides 'short term' insurance for a week, fortnight or month, ideal for those trips back to the UK. Contact is Huseyin 0533-8518746. For those members that have 'Staysure' policies, your existing policy is valid but as from 18th July, we have been advised that no new policies will be issued to any person that is not a member of the European Union. Smacks of politics again. An alternative can be provided by Esta. Contact Huseyin or Anthony for further information.'

Their quote not mine - I'm sure they mean any member who is not residing in the EU.

I have just spoken with Staysure and they have confirmed that people living in North Cyprus are covered on their policies. Their comment was "we treat the whole of Cyprus as one so it makes no difference to us if you live in the North or the South!"
